Gaming cards are extensively used now in games including twenty-one, poker, baccarat plus in countless non-gambling cool games. It is intriguing, that cards are already created long ago in human culture historical past and prevailed until nowadays.

In the past 1 / 2 of the 14th century dealers revealed that which was then normally called "Saracen cards" into medieval Europe. Those who had survived the bubonic beat relocated to urban area, where they developed a new class of traders and craftsmen - the metropolitan bourgeois. Once the poverty and discrimination with the dark era reduced, work, guilds, and colleges attempt to restore, and latest technological approaches were noticed with the time for entertainment, fun, and joy.

In the earlier days in the Renaissance, literature, cards and editions were produced manually. Card games were broaden across Italy by way of a group of craft appreciators formed currently. At the end from the 14th century many main metros in Europe as well as Viterbo in Italy, Paris and Barcelona, could achieve illuminated manuscripts of card instructions. Travelling artists and scholars unfold these manuscripts everywhere in the continent as well as their popularity flourished. Early in the 15 century, a 1 performer was enough to match the demand of an urban area. By mid-century, nonetheless, immediately grew to become an excuse for several stores devoted to their formation.

Card manuscripts just weren't cherished by all the people. Indeed numerous were threatened with this strange entertainment and discovered it like a capacity to promote betting so when an nefarious and counter social product from the devil. At the time with the protestant Reformation, the cards were known as as "Devil Pictures."

Nonetheless, the way endured. Mary, Queen of Scots, liked to bet big even on Sundays and also by late XVII century London presented The Compleat Gamester, rehearsing over a dozen game types and the basic methods for every one of them. In Venice, exotic shops - casini - admitted fortunate aristocrats for card games and courtesans. From there, a game title named primero spread to Europe and domino99 then transformed in poker.

After many years, the overall game was played and liked by ladies in addition to guys, farmers, carpenters, and dealers in addition to courtesans and aristocrats. The suits at the time from your popular Swedish deck were so as of rank: sun, king, queen, knight, dame, valet and maid. In Florence, cards were outlined as nude dames and dancers, with dancers being the least expensive level.

There was no typical level of cards or models in a deck in those days. The number of cards could actually vary from thirty-six to 40 or maybe even fladskrrrm. The suits in the time were pictorial of wealth, tasty rations, defense force defense, and sports favored by legal court. These were coins, cups, sabers, and clubs. Symbols familiar to us were getting used in France in the fifteenth century: in red, Couers (Hearts) stood for the church, carreaux (a square floor tile) symbolized the company class; in black, there are piques (stab and arrow heads) depicting authority, and trifles (trefoil clover leaf) as a symbol in the farmers. Some heroic soul at one point as you go along ditched the vice-royals for queens.

After a period, those times of cards that we recognize now took form. fifty-two cards with ranks enclosing four special suits. The suits incorporate Spades, Diamonds, Hearts, and Clubs while using Ace, King, Queen, and Jack counting for ten as well as the rest in the cards, 2 through 10, being counted at their face number.
